Step-by-step explanation:
Prob (Ball target & prize ) = 0.74
Prob (Ball no target & no prize) = 1 - 0.74 = 0.26
Three Balls : Prob (atleast 1 prize) = 1 - Prob (No ball target & no price)
= 1 - (0.26)^3
= 1 - 0.017576
= 0.982424

I think that supposed to be (wx - y^2)^2?
If so, multiply using FOIL:
First: wx * wx = w^2x^2
Outside: wx * -y^2 = -wxy^2
Inside: -y * wx = -wxy^2
Last: -y^2 * -y^2 = y^4
Combine w^2x^2 - 2wxy^2 + y^4
